Table 2:  Commercially Available Prophylactic Vaccines for HPV

Vaccine Indications Schedule Adverse Effects
Quadrivalent (HPV 6/11/16/18, Gardasil, Merck, Whitehouse Station, New Jersey) Should be routinely offered to all females 11-12 years old

 

Can vaccinate as young as 9 years old, and as old as 26 years old if not previously vaccinated

 

Boys and men 9-26 years old can also be vaccinated
Three doses at time 0, month 2 and month 6

 

 

Minimal

 

Mild to moderate localized pain, erythema, swelling

 

Systemic reactions, mainly fever, seen in 4% of recipients
